This information is incorrect regarding CDW coverage when using UR points to book the car rental. The Chase benefits guide states the following in the CDW section:
You are covered when Your name is embossed on an eligible card issued in the United States, and You use Your credit card Account and/or rewards programs associated with Your Account to initiate and complete Your entire car rental transaction. Only You, as the primary renter of the vehicle, and any additional drivers permitted by the Rental Car Agreement are covered
So in summary, when using Ultimate Rewards points to book a car rental through the Chase travel portal I get the same CDW coverage as when using my credit card and charging $ to my card.
I also updated the Chase CDW forum with this info as we are getting a little off topic from the original thread post but I wanted to make this clear because its an important issue.